The Kitchen Whole Foods Chipotle Chicken Wrap

On 2014-04-23 the FDA classified a Class II recall of The Kitchen Whole Foods Chipotle Chicken Wrap by Whole Foods Market, citing one production date of Chicken Chipotle Chicken wraps are actually filled with Chicken Caesar mix which contains a fish allergen (anchovies) that are not declared on the label.
